Effective retirement packages are vital for companies in the region to remain competitive. That’s the word from the human resources consultancy Mercer, which says firms need to put these measures in place if they want expat-employees to extend their stay. The UAE is an attractive long-term career destination for expats, but the new report shows this trend is not being matched with offers of enhanced end-of-service benefits. Mercer says well-designed retirement packages could help companies benefit from increased employee engagement and loyalty.
